Job Requisition ID # 25WD92802 Position Overview Are you tenacious and have experience building trusted relationships? Do you love the craft of sales, especially complex enterprise-level sales? The Account Executive, Mid Market is responsible for growing sales in ~40 accounts within Autodesku2019s Construction business. This job is assigned a sales quota and performance is measured by meeting quarterly and annual targets by up-selling, add-on sales, and cross-selling. This position is remote and reports to the Mid Market Sales Manager for the Northeast US region. The assigned territory is predominantly in the NY/NJ metro area. Youu2019ll be a trusted advisor for customers. Youu2019ll increase sales by expanding renewals and displacing competitive products. This is a rare opportunity to join Autodesku2019s fast-growth construction business. Youu2019ll make an impact and bring much-needed technology to the construction industry. Responsibilities + Manage your book of business; sell new products and expand existing renewals to meet quarterly targets + Lead account strategy and manage the sales cycle for new sales and renewals + Produce new opportunity pipeline each week to meet quarterly and annual quota targets + Be a model representative of Autodesk. Lead presentations to clients, build trusted-advisor relationships with customers, and attend marketing events/conferences + Exemplify team-selling culture. Learn more about our benefits in the U.S. by visiting Salary transparency Salary is one part of Autodesku2019s competitive compensation package. For U.S.-based sales roles, we expect a starting On-Target Earnings (OTE) between $208,100 and $373,010. OTE is comprised of base salary plus commission target for sales roles. Offers are based on the candidateu2019s experience and geographic location and may exceed this range. In addition to base salaries, our compensation package may include annual cash bonuses, commissions for sales roles, stock grants, and a comprehensive benefits package.
